In May 2020, the IDB approved a US$750,000 (TT$5.1 million) grant to support CARPHA in the coordination of the regional health response to the coronavirus (COVID-19) pandemic. In the Caribbean region, cancer is the second leading cause of death. However, a significant number of cancer deaths can largely be prevented through primary prevention, screening and early detection, timely diagnosis and treatment.
